Understanding the IELTS Test Structure
Before starting a preparation journey, it is crucial to acquaint oneself with the exam's format. buy original ielts certificate without exam consists of four modules: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. The Academic version is usually required for university admission, while the General Training variation is utilized for immigration and office functions.
ModuleVariety of QuestionsPeriodContent FocusListening40Thirty minutes (plus 10 minutes to move responses)Conversations and monologues in everyday social contextsChecking out4060 minutesThree long texts (Academic) or shorter passages (General Training)Writing2 tasks60 minutesJob 1: describe visual information (Academic) or compose a letter (General Training); Task 2: essaySpeaking3 parts11-- 14 minutesIntroduction, cue card discussion, and follow‑up concerns
Comprehending the timing and question types is the initial step toward a "ensured" outcome, as it enables candidates to assign research study time effectively.
A Step‑by‑Step Plan to Secure Your IELTS Certificate
Below is a methodical method that, when abided by, maximises the likelihood of achieving the desired band score.

Assess Your Current Level
Take an official practice test or a reliable online diagnostic to identify your baseline band. Determine strengths and weak points throughout the four modules.
Set a Realistic Target Band
Validate the minimum rating needed by your university, immigration program, or company. Pick a target that is one band higher than the minimum to produce a safety margin.
Create a Study Schedule
Allocate 6-- 8 weeks for extensive preparation (longer if your standard is far from the target). Dedicate everyday blocks: e.g., 1 hour Listening, 1 hour Reading, 1.5 hours Writing, and 30 minutes Speaking.
Use Official Materials
IELTS.org offers totally free sample tests and band‑score descriptors. The Cambridge IELTS series (Books 17-- 19) uses genuine past documents. Main apps (e.g., IELTS Liz, British Council's "TakeIELTS") include timed practice.
Practice Under Test Conditions
Imitate the exam environment: strict timing, no breaks, and a peaceful space. After each full‑length practice test, review answers thoroughly and keep in mind repeating errors.
Seek Professional Feedback
Enrol in a trusted preparation course (e.g., IDP, British Council, or a licensed local language school). Usage experienced tutors for composing and speaking assessments; their targeted remarks are vital.
Establish Test‑Day Strategies
Listening: Read ahead, look for signal words, and transfer answers without delay. Checking out: Skim passages for essences, then scan for information. Writing: Spend the first 5 minutes planning both jobs; abide by the word count (minimum 150 for Task 1, 250 for Task 2). Speaking: Maintain eye contact, respond to each question completely, and utilize a variety of grammatical structures.Recommended Resources

Common Pitfalls and How to Avoid ThemPoor Time Management-- Many prospects lack time in Reading and Writing. Practice with a timer and learn to avoid challenging questions momentarily. Ignoring Speaking Practice-- Speaking is typically the least practiced module. Schedule at least three mock interviews with a partner or tutor before the exam. Relying on "Brain Dumps"-- Some websites claim to provide "guaranteed" questions. These are undependable and may breach test security policies. Concentrate on authentic ability development instead. Disregarding Band Descriptors-- Understanding the assessment criteria (Task Response, Coherence & & Cohesion, Lexical Resource, Grammatical Range) helps prospects target particular enhancement locations.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
